The Simple Link Directory pl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to unauthorized access due to a missing capability check on a function in all versions up to, and including, 8.8.3.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to perform an unauthorized action.

The Simple Link Directory WordPress plugin before 7.7.2 does not validate and escape the post_id parameter before using it in a SQL statement via the qcopd_upvote_action AJAX action (available to unauthenticated and authenticated users), leading to an unauthenticated SQL Injectio...
An XSS vulnerability in qcopd-shortcode-generator.php in the Simple Link Directory plugin before 7.3.5 for WordPress all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ML, because esc_html is not called for the "echo get_the_title()" or "echo $term->name" statement.
